Hi guys, wasn't sure where to put this, but since I received help from someone on the help thread and did some trial and error with that help I created a Contest Move-Set for one of our Hoenn region Pokemon: Masquerain!

Notes: With Max PokeBlock Stat, You Will Always Go First In The Talent Round.

Here it is if anyone feels like playing Masquerain on ORAS (And Must Have Max PokeBlock Stat In These Categories Though):

Beauty Contest Set (Normal Through Master Rank):

-Water Pulse Or Flash - 1st and/or 3rd Move (Makes Audience Expect Little Of Other Contestants) (Has 3 Hearts)
-Energy Ball - 2nd Move (Quite An Appealing Move) (Has 4 Hearts)
-Giga Drain - 3rd/4th Move (Badly Startles All Pokemon That Successfully Showed Their Appeal) (1 Heart, But Has 4 Jam Hearts Which Minuses Any Hearts From The Previous Pokemon In The Order)
-Hyper Beam - 5th Move (Startles All Pokemon That Went Before The User) (Has A Decent Amount Of Hearts, Even Though It's A Cool Move)

And Another One I Just Did With Masquerain:

Tough Contest Set (Normal Through Master Rank):

-Scald - 1st (Makes The Remaining Pokemon Nervous) (2 Hearts)
-Thief - 2nd/3rd (Shows Off The Pokemon Appeal About As Well As The Move Used Just Before It) (1 Heart + More Added From Last Move On Last Pokemon That Went)
-Giga Drain - Depends What Kind Of Situation You're In, This one is a Clever Move But Once Again, It Has 4 Jam Hearts (Badly Startles The Last Pokemon To Act Before The User)
-Giga Impact - 4th and/or 5th (Startles All Other Pokemon, User Cannot Act In The Next Turn) (4 Hearts, 4 Jam Hearts) Basically The Tough Version Of Hyper Beam But It Depends What Order You're In On The 5th Round

Final Notes: These Sets Work Great, Order Isn't Always Accurate Though Since It Varies And Mostly Just Wanted To Help. :)

Don't worry, he'll respawn once you beat the E4. From B1F of Cave of Origin, go thru the left door that's been freshly opened up, instead of climbing down to the bottom like you did during the story. It's a straight path down several flights of stairs to where Kyogre rests, you can't miss him.
